Tottenham Hotspur fans received a positive piece of news this morning to sweep away the Monday blues, with attacking starlet Dele Alli signing a new contract to keep him in North London until 2022.
The former MK Dons attacking midfielder has had a whirlwind 12 months since joining the White Hart Lane side.

Alli was an integral part of Mauricio Pochettino’s side that finished third in the Premier League last season and contributed a number of important goals.
The 20-year-old went on to be named PFA Young Player of the Year and won the Goal of the Season award for his acrobatic volley against Crystal Palace.
Alli has since gone on to become a fully fledged England international and will be a critical player in Spurs’ hopes of finishing in the top four again this season.
